Frontegg is a SaaS-as-a-Service platform offering companies a range of common SaaS capabilities easily integratable into any environment. Frontegg targets both early-stage startups, midsize companies aiming to grow, as well as fully-fledged enterprises. Its solutions comprise three major verticals, such as Security, Connectivity, and Engagement. Source: about 3 years ago
